Superhero fatigue apparently exists, but the problem may have less to do with superheroes and more about the failure to tell a compelling story. Speaking to Rolling Stone in a new interview regarding his new film, Guardians of the Galaxy Vol. 3, which hits U.S. theaters on May 5, 2023, James Gunn touched upon the topic of superhero fatigue, telling the publication that while the problem exists, it's the lack of an emotionally grounded story, rather than superhero characters, that is mainly to blame. Gunn suggested that today's superhero films have too much "nonsense," such as characters just bashing each other.
